Family friendly hiking trails around Embalse de El Pardo are set within the Monte de El Pardo, a significant Mediterranean forest near Madrid. This area is characterized by gently undulating terrain and is part of the Regional Park of the Upper Manzanares Basin. The Manzanares River flows through the region, feeding the reservoir and creating a diverse ecosystem. The landscape features extensive holm oak forests, alongside gall oaks, junipers, and cork oaks, with ash and willow trees lining the riverbanks.

The Mingorrubio footbridge is a metal pedestrian structure that crosses the Manzanares River in the El Pardo area (Madrid). It is a key point for cyclists and hikers, allowing the completion of circular routes through the protected natural environment.

La Fuente de Valpalomero is a historic water point located in the Monte de El Pardo (Madrid). This fountain is built with three stone blocks from the demolished Iglesia del Buen Suceso and supplies fresh water to hikers and cyclists.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many family-friendly hiking trails are there around Embalse de El Pardo?

Embalse de El Pardo offers a wide variety of hiking options, with over 100 routes available on komoot. For families, there are at least 30 trails specifically rated as easy, making them suitable for most ages and abilities.

Are there any easy circular routes suitable for families?

Yes, the area is rich in easy circular routes perfect for families. A great option is the Manzanares River – El Pardo Reservoir loop, which is about 5.1 km long and offers beautiful riverside scenery. Another excellent choice is the Monte de El Pardo – circular by the Río Manzanares, also around 5.4 km, providing a pleasant walk through the forest.

What kind of natural features can we expect to see on family hikes?

The trails around Embalse de El Pardo wind through the expansive Monte de El Pardo, one of Europe's best-preserved Mediterranean forests. You'll encounter holm oaks, gall oaks, and junipers, especially along the scenic Manzanares River. The area is also a Specially Protected Bird Area (ZEPA), so keep an eye out for diverse bird species, and you might even spot deer or wild boar.

Are there any specific points of interest or landmarks along the family trails?

Absolutely! Many routes offer views of the impressive El Pardo Reservoir Dam. For panoramic vistas, the Valpalomero Viewpoint on Monte de El Pardo provides stunning views of the pastureland, the Manzanares River, and the El Pardo Palace in the distance. While the palace itself is a separate visit, its presence adds to the historical charm of the area.

Is Embalse de El Pardo suitable for families with strollers?

Many paths around Embalse de El Pardo are well-maintained and relatively flat, making them suitable for strollers. The Senda Fluvial del Manzanares, a popular 6 km trail along the river, is particularly known for its accessibility and is often recommended for those with strollers or reduced mobility.

Can we bring our dog on the family-friendly hikes?

Yes, Embalse de El Pardo is generally dog-friendly. Many trails welcome dogs, allowing your furry family members to enjoy the outdoor adventure with you. However, always ensure your dog is kept under control, especially given the diverse wildlife in the Monte de El Pardo, which is a protected natural space.

What is the best time of year to go hiking with family in Embalse de El Pardo?

The spring and autumn months are ideal for family hiking in Embalse de El Pardo. The weather is typically mild and pleasant, and the natural scenery is at its most vibrant. Summer can be quite hot, so if you visit then, it's best to go early in the morning or late in the afternoon to avoid the midday heat.

Where can we park when visiting Embalse de El Pardo for family hikes?

There are several parking areas available, with the Somontes parking area being a popular starting point for many trails, including the Senda Fluvial del Manzanares. It's advisable to arrive early, especially on weekends, to secure a spot.

Are there any places to eat or have a picnic near the trails?

Yes, there are picnic areas available for visitors to enjoy a packed lunch amidst nature. Additionally, the Merendero de El Pardo is a refreshment area located along some routes, offering a convenient spot to rest and grab a bite to eat.
